Louis Robert ‘Louie’ Zetko – Roscoe

By obits

 

Louis Robert “Louie” Zetko, 70, of Roscoe, passed away unexpectedly on Aug. 18, 2023. He was born Feb. 19, 1953, in Charleroi, to Olive and Louis Zetko. Louie is survived by niece and nephew, Natalie and Chad Marsland; great-niece and great-nephew, Katie Nield and Joe Marsland; brother-in-law, Charles Marsland; and numerous cousins, nieces and nephews. Louie was predeceased by his mother, Olive Zetko; father, Louis “Harpo” Zetko; and sister, Jeanne Marsland. Louie worked at Wheeling-Pittsburgh Steel Corporation, Allenport Works, until it closed and then joined IPSCO in Roscoe, from which he retired. An avid sports fan, Louie, followed all of the Pittsburgh sports teams and regularly traveled to away games to cheer on the Steelers and have a few beers. A life member of the Slovak Beneficial Society of Roscoe and the California Young Men’s Club, Louie could be found sitting quietly enjoying a beer. Louie was a simple, hard-working, blue-collar man, the epitome of the Mon Valley, where he was born, raised, lived and died. There will be a memorial at the Slovak Beneficial Society of Roscoe with the date and time to be determined. If you can’t make it, honor Louie the way he would approve of, have a cold beer and just enjoy the time. Arrangements have been entrusted to MELENYZER FUNERAL HOMES & CREMATION SERVICES INC., Roscoe.
